Founding Partner Bob Underwood has over thirty years of experience counseling business owners and senior management, acquiring small companies, and developing them into significantly larger enterprises. Bob has been a director of nineteen private companies, two publicly-traded companies, and one technology-oriented mutual fund, and was the only outside director of London-based BP plc’s solar energy subsidiary. He is a long-time past member of the Advisory Board for Santa Clara University’s Leavey School of Business and of the National Science Foundation’s Advisory Committee on Industrial Innovation. Bob holds a BS in Mechanical Engineering and a MS and PhD in Engineering Sciences, all from Stanford University, and an MBA from Santa Clara University. He authored the highly acclaimed history of hydroelectricity, Dam It! Electrifying America and Taming Her Waterways. He holds one US patent.
